Joy-Con Toolkit全解掌控Switch手柄的开源解决方案【免费下载链接】jc_toolkitJoy-Con Toolkit项目地址: https://gitcode.com/gh_mirrors/jc/jc_toolkitJoy-Con Toolkitjc_toolkit是一款专为Nintendo Switch手柄打造的开源工具集通过直观的交互界面与深度硬件控制能力帮助用户实现手柄个性化定制、硬件故障诊断与性能优化。无论是普通玩家还是开发人员都能通过该工具释放Joy-Con手柄的全部潜力解决从日常使用到专业调试的各类需求。一、核心价值定位重新定义手柄控制体验Joy-Con Toolkit的诞生填补了Switch手柄管理工具的空白其核心价值体现在三个维度 •全面硬件掌控突破官方限制实现手柄硬件参数的深度调节 •可视化操作界面将复杂的硬件调试转化为直观的图形操作 •开源生态支持基于开放架构设计支持功能扩展与二次开发二、分阶能力体系从入门到专家的全场景覆盖★ 入门级功能即装即用的个性化工具核心痛点官方工具功能有限无法满足个性化需求•色彩定制系统通过frmJoyConColorPicker.cs实现手柄LED颜色的精准调节支持RGB与HSL双模式控制•预设方案管理内置多种游戏主题配色可通过retail_colors.xml扩展自定义方案•一键应用功能简化操作流程新手用户也能在3步内完成颜色设置★ 进阶级功能硬件健康与性能优化核心痛点手柄漂移、续航不足等硬件问题影响游戏体验•智能校准系统通过AnalogStickCalc算法解决摇杆漂移问题支持自定义死区设置•电池监控中心实时显示电量状态提供健康度评估与充电建议•传感器调试面板可视化展示陀螺仪与加速度计数据辅助硬件故障诊断★ 专家级功能开发者的硬件调试平台核心痛点缺乏官方调试接口第三方开发门槛高•HID通信监控通过hid.c实现手柄通信数据的实时捕获与分析•协议解析工具支持Joy-Con专有通信协议的解析与自定义命令发送•固件参数编辑提供EEPROM数据读写功能实现高级硬件参数配置三、实战场景指南解决真实使用难题场景一竞技游戏的摇杆精度优化目标提升《Apex英雄》等竞技游戏的操作精准度连接手柄并启动Joy-Con Toolkit进入摇杆校准模块执行自动校准流程根据游戏类型调整死区参数建议竞技游戏5-8%休闲游戏10-15%保存配置并进行实战测试 注意校准前请确保摇杆处于自然居中位置避免物理阻碍场景二续航延长方案实施目标提升手柄续航时间50%以上在电池监控界面查看当前电池健康度建议低于80%进行维护降低LED亮度至30%路径设置 硬件 LED控制禁用非必要的传感器功能路径高级 传感器管理启用节能模式自动降低无线传输频率场景三开发自定义色彩方案目标为《塞尔达传说》主题创建专属手柄配色打开色彩选择器使用取色工具获取游戏截图中的主色调调整饱和度至85%亮度至90%以匹配OLED屏幕显示效果保存为Zelda_Theme并导出配置文件分享配置到社区或导入其他设备四、技术架构解析模块化设计的优势核心模块结构jc_toolkit/ ├── jctool/ # 主程序目录 │ ├── jc_colorpicker/ # 色彩管理模块 │ ├── original_res/ # 资源文件目录 │ ├── hid.c # HID通信实现 │ └── jctool.cpp # 主逻辑处理跨平台通信层设计功能优势适用场景HIDAPI封装跨Windows/macOS/Linux平台多系统支持需求异步通信机制避免界面卡顿实时数据监控错误恢复系统自动重连与数据校验稳定连接保障色彩处理核心AdobeColors.cs实现了专业级色彩空间转换支持 • RGB/HSL/CMYK多模式转换• 色彩温度调节算法• 色域压缩与扩展处理五、安装与使用指南环境准备•操作系统Windows 7/8/10/11需.NET Framework 4.7.1•开发环境Visual Studio 2017或更高版本•依赖组件Microsoft Visual C 2017 Redistributable快速安装步骤克隆项目仓库git clone https://gitcode.com/gh_mirrors/jc/jc_toolkit打开解决方案文件jctool.vs2017-net4.7.1.sln选择Release配置并构建项目运行生成的可执行文件位于bin/Release目录基础使用流程连接Joy-Con手柄到电脑支持有线/蓝牙连接等待工具自动识别设备首次连接可能需要安装驱动在主界面选择所需功能模块根据向导完成设置并应用六、高级应用与扩展自定义算法开发开发者可通过修改AnalogStickCalc函数实现自定义摇杆处理算法步骤如下理解原始数据格式16位ADC值实现新的滤波或校准算法编译测试版本并进行实际设备验证提交PR贡献到主项目硬件功能扩展通过扩展hid.c中的通信协议处理可以 • 添加对新硬件的支持• 实现自定义振动模式• 开发专属硬件诊断工具结语Joy-Con Toolkit通过开源模式打破了官方工具的限制为Switch玩家和开发者提供了前所未有的手柄控制能力。无论是追求个性化体验的普通用户还是需要深度硬件调试的专业开发者都能在这个工具集中找到满足需求的解决方案。随着社区的不断贡献该工具将持续进化为Joy-Con手柄释放更多潜在可能。【免费下载链接】jc_toolkitJoy-Con Toolkit项目地址: https://gitcode.com/gh_mirrors/jc/jc_toolkit创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考